Little League International Mourns the Passing of New Jersey District 5 Assistant District Administrator George Spero

By Communications Division
SOUTH WILLIAMSPORT, Pa.
March 20, 2012

Little League International mourns the passing of Assistant New Jersey District 5 Administrator George Spero. He was 72.

Mr. Spero of Lodi, N.J., served as Assistant New Jersey District 5 Administrator for 25 years, and provided 34 years of volunteer service to Lodi Oldtimers Little League.

The league’s Vice President at the time of his passing, Mr. Spero held every position on the Lodi Oldtimers Little League board of directors and was along-time coach.

Mr. Spero, a former plant supervisor for Pan Technologies in Carlstadt, N.J.,  is survived by his wife, Rosemary, daughter, Rosemary Lipari; sons Thomas and Anthony; and grandchildren Danielle Spero, Zachary Spero, Marc Lipari and Timothy Lipari; sisters Ann Giglio, Louise Belmonte and  brother John Spero.
